Ethan’s portrait
Here’s the portrait that was a commissioned birthday present for my brother’s girlfriend’s brother. His sister wanted an distinguished portrait of him. I thought nothing was more pompus than one of those ruffled collars and a hamlet pose. The original artwork was Frans Hals – Portrait of a Man Holding a Skull. It was featured on the front page of Reddit. http://www.reddit.com/r/pics/comments/ojmgb/my_sister_decided_that_no_one_should_reach_30/ I used a low res image of the original painting and repainted it in Photoshop with new brushstrokes so that it looked painted...

Read MoreKrstić study 1
This image is from Human Microscopic Anatomy by R.V. Krstić. I did a pencil tracing of the pen and ink image Plate 14. Survey of blood elements in a sinus of the bone marrow. I then used that sketch as a basis for practice coloring and painting in Photoshop. I played with a color pallet and other techniques. It is unfinished and I may base a new original piece on some of what I learned from doing this...
